Mohka Population - Mahasamund, Chhattisgarh

Mohka is a medium size village located in Basna Tehsil of Mahasamund district, Chhattisgarh with total 276 families residing. The Mohka village has population of 1210 of which 576 are males while 634 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Mohka village population of children with age 0-6 is 131 which makes up 10.83 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mohka village is 1101 which is higher than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Mohka as per census is 1079, higher than Chhattisgarh average of 969.

Mohka village has higher liter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Mohka village was 79.43 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Mohka Male literacy stands at 86.94 % while female literacy rate was 72.61 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 24.88 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 1.40 % of total population in Mohka village.

Work Profile

In Mohka village out of total population, 571 were engaged in work activities. 36.78 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 63.22 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 571 workers engaged in Main Work, 127 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 36 were Agricultural labourer.
